Redagowanie tekstu w dokumentach w formacie Rich Text (RTF) przy użyciu języka Java to ważna umiejętność dla programistów, którzy chcą zwiększyć prywatność i bezpieczeństwo danych. W tym artykule omówimy proces redagowania tekstu w formacie RTF przy użyciu programowania w języku Java. Ta wiedza jest istotna przy opracowywaniu aplikacji zarządzających poufnymi informacjami i wymagających funkcji redagowania tekstu. Zanim zagłębimy się w aspekty techniczne, najważniejsze jest zrozumienie znaczenia redakcji. Redagowanie tekstu oznacza ukrywanie lub usuwanie poufnych informacji z dokumentów, aby zapobiec nieuprawnionemu dostępowi lub ujawnieniu. Jest to szczególnie ważne w przypadku dokumentów prawnych, raportów finansowych i poufnej komunikacji, gdzie ochrona prywatności danych ma kluczowe znaczenie. Poniższe kluczowe kroki i przykładowy kod poprowadzą Cię, jak zamienić tekst w formacie RTF przy użyciu języka Java.
Kroki redagowania tekstu w formacie RTF przy użyciu języka Java
- Skonfiguruj swój program kodujący tak, aby używał GroupDocs.Redaction for Java do redagowania tekstu w plikach RTF
- Utwórz instancję klasy Redactor, przekazując ścieżkę pliku RTF do jej konstruktora
- Utwórz instancję klasy ExactPhraseRedaction, podając frazę do redakcji i obiekt ReplacementOptions
- Wywołaj metodę Redactor.apply, przekazując obiekt ExactPhraseRedaction, aby zastosować redakcję
- Utwórz instancję obiektu SaveOptions dostosowanego do Twoich konkretnych potrzeb
- Użyj metody Redactor.save z opcjami zapisu, aby zapisać zmodyfikowany plik RTF na dysku
Opanowanie procesu usuwania wrażliwych danych z formatu RTF przy użyciu języka Java jest kluczową umiejętnością programistów. Wyposaża ich w narzędzia potrzebne do ochrony wrażliwych informacji, zapewnienia poufności dokumentów i zachowania standardów prywatności danych. Wykonując kroki opisane w tym artykule i wykorzystując możliwości zalecanej biblioteki, programiści mogą znacznie zwiększyć bezpieczeństwo dokumentów. Przyczynia się to do ustanowienia niezawodnego i zgodnego środowiska zarządzania danymi, co jest niezbędne w dzisiejszym cyfrowym krajobrazie.
Kod do redagowania tekstu w formacie RTF przy użyciu języka Java
import com.groupdocs.redaction.Redactor; | |
import com.groupdocs.redaction.licensing.License; | |
import com.groupdocs.redaction.options.SaveOptions; | |
import com.groupdocs.redaction.redactions.ExactPhraseRedaction; | |
import com.groupdocs.redaction.redactions.ReplacementOptions; | |
public class RedactTextinRTFusingJava { | |
public static void main(String[] args) throws Exception { | |
// Set License to avoid the limitations of Redaction library | |
License license = new License(); | |
license.setLicense("GroupDocs.Redaction.lic"); | |
final Redactor redactor = new Redactor("input.rtf"); | |
redactor.apply(new ExactPhraseRedaction("John Doe", | |
new ReplacementOptions("[personal]"))); | |
// Saving in original format | |
SaveOptions saveOptions = new SaveOptions(); | |
saveOptions.setAddSuffix(true); | |
saveOptions.setRasterizeToPDF(false); | |
redactor.save(saveOptions); | |
redactor.close(); | |
} | |
} |
Jeśli masz już zainstalowaną Javę na swoim komputerze, możesz z łatwością wykonać powyższe kroki w systemie Windows, macOS lub Linux. Nie ma potrzeby instalowania żadnego dodatkowego oprogramowania, aby wyszukiwać i redagować tekst w formacie RTF przy użyciu języka Java. Po skonfigurowaniu zalecanej biblioteki i dostosowaniu ścieżek plików możesz bezproblemowo dodać dostarczony przykładowy kod do swoich projektów, nie napotykając żadnych problemów. Ten prosty proces gwarantuje płynne wykonanie w różnych systemach operacyjnych, bez polegania na dodatkowym oprogramowaniu.
W naszej poprzedniej dyskusji przedstawiliśmy szczegółowy przewodnik na temat redagowania tekstu w plikach XLSX przy użyciu języka Java. Aby uzyskać pełniejsze zrozumienie, zalecamy zapoznanie się z naszym obszernym samouczkiem skupiającym się szczególnie na tym, jak zredaguj tekst w formacie XLSX przy użyciu Java.